Output dbf62624a174f098eece99ee7564fddb1b6f54ea7f4a555e7dc1d88eb1804f99:1

value
558001957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aff410e9e727f47c89346b159f3724c6d336d3d OP_EQUAL
address
3P7ZpoM7XE9aZLy93WEhVhACJj1aY5gaAD
transaction
dbf62624a174f098eece99ee7564fddb1b6f54ea7f4a555e7dc1d88eb1804f99
spent
true